The MRI Technologist prepares patients for testing (including thorough screening questioning), assists the radiologist during testing, operates the MRI equipment for a variety of procedures, and maintains supply inventory in assigned rooms.

This full-time, night shift position is three 12-hour shifts/week (Wednesday, Thursday, Friday) with no on-call requirement.

Responsibilities And Duties:

Operates MRI equipment, including the magnet, injectors, independent consoles, physiological patient monitors, and cardiac gating/monitoring equipment.

Uses equipment to properly adjust pulse sequences according to body part and diagnosis.

Demonstrates correct and adequate anatomic positioning skills.

Performs daily safety and quality control checks for the system.

Sends images to PACS for interpretation.

Transfers images to independent console for further manipulation.

Reformats and performs post processing of images for radiologist interpretation.

Administers MRI contrast agents
